Acute diverticulitis, a common condition, can rarely cause ureteral obstruction leading to hydronephrosis. This case highlights the importance of considering urinary tract complications in patients presenting with abdominal pain.

Area of Science:

  • Gastroenterology
  • Urology

Background:

  • Acute diverticulitis is a frequent gastrointestinal condition.
  • Known complications include abscess, perforation, obstruction, and fistula formation.

Observation:

  • A rare case of a 40-year-old male patient with diverticulitis is presented.
  • The patient presented with a perisigmoid abscess.
  • The abscess was complicated by left-sided hydronephrosis.

Findings:

  • This case demonstrates a rare ureteral complication of acute diverticulitis.
  • Perisigmoid abscess formation can lead to secondary hydronephrosis.
  • Prompt diagnosis and treatment are crucial for managing such complications.

Implications:

  • Clinicians should consider ureteral complications like hydronephrosis in patients with diverticulitis.
  • Early recognition of this rare presentation can prevent delayed treatment and adverse outcomes.
  • This finding expands the spectrum of known diverticulitis complications.

The kidneys are intricate organs with millions of working units known as nephrons. Each nephron features two major structures: the renal corpuscle, which facilitates blood plasma filtration, and the renal tubule, which handles the glomerular filtrate. Blood supply is directly linked to the nephrons.
